Step 1
Preheat the oven to 375F degrees. Line baking sheets with parchment paper; set aside.
Step 2
In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
Step 3
In large bowl, cream the butter and both sugars together with an electric mixer on high until light and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es. Beat in the vanilla and eggs.
Step 4
While mixing on low speed, slowly add in the flour mixture. Fold in the oats and raisins until fully incorporated.
Step 5
Use a cookie scoop to scoop the dough into 1 1/2-inch dough balls and place two inches apart on the prepared cookie sheets.
Step 6
Bake the cookies for 12-14 minutes until slightly golden around the edges. Cool for 5 minutes on the baking sheets, then transfer to a wire cooling rack.
